Transaction 509065d4b5fba392d8210a9a4852823ecf09534dde46eaa4c7356b7183489810

1 Input
2 Outputs
  • 509065d4b5fba392d8210a9a4852823ecf09534dde46eaa4c7356b7183489810:0
  • value  951700
    address  35NByXk8EGHAEq7MUgqG6nULk9yLPSCgPv
  • 509065d4b5fba392d8210a9a4852823ecf09534dde46eaa4c7356b7183489810:1
  • value  5705
    address  32GNvWHEVKSEXxbEGtrZnbLcmpRwHJmBg4